These boots are more than just a trend. They bring serious style with a 1.75-inch platform, plush faux fur lining, and suede uppers that give them that signature UGG look we all love. The asymmetrical topline and spill seam stitch detailing add a modern edge, while the rear pull tab makes them easy to slip on and dash out the door.
Available in several versatile colors, these platform pull-ons are the perfect combo of edgy and comfy. Whether you're pairing them with leggings and a flannel or styling them with jeans and a chunky sweater, these boots are guaranteed to earn compliments—and keep your feet toasty.
